Food for thought and your belly.

Meatpaper invites you to the San Francisco launch party for Issue 6 at Acme Chophouse! Scope out our first butchery demonstration as Chef Ryan Farr breaks down a whole pig. Snack through a nose-to-tail beef cooking presentation from Sam White and Chris Kronner. And to sweeten the deal, Staffan Terje will serve his famous charcuterie and now infamous meat desserts (bacon marshmallows!) Executive Chef Thom Fox of Acme will be dishing up rotisserie meats and there will be seasonal vegetarian dishes from Leif Hedendal. Cocktails, wine and beer will be flowing.

ABOUT ACME CHOPHOUSE:
Acme is about environmental responsibility and healthful produce: naturally, locally raised meats and poultry, locally caught fish and just-picked produce from small organic farms. All the meat on the menu is naturally raised without hormones or antibiotics. Every night Acme offers meat that is grass fed and healthier for people and the planet. “Acme references the old San Francisco and the grilled and roasted meats from my childhood,” says managing chef, Traci des Jardins.

Nominated for several Utne Independent Press Awards, Meatpaper is a quarterly print journal focused on art and ideas about meat. Inspired by the current "fleischgeist" that is sweeping the world, Meatpaper publishes lush visuals, provocative articles, and timely reporting. Neither pro nor con, Meatpaper's ambidextrous approach and innovative format have generated international press.
